How Sulphur in Onions Tackles Fridge Odours
Onions are rich in sulphur-containing compounds such as S-alk(en)yl-L-cysteine sulfoxides, which break down into reactive volatiles. These can bind with or reduce certain volatile organic compounds responsible for fridge funk, especially amines from ageing proteins and some sulphurous notes from brassicas and eggs. While part of the effect is simple masking—onion has a strong aroma—there is also genuine odour neutralisation at play when reactive sulphur species meet unstable stink molecules. Airflow inside the fridge spreads these volatiles quickly, so a small piece can make a big difference fast. The effect is most noticeable in the first few minutes, tapering as the onion dries and its chemistry slows. Expect rapid relief, not a permanent cure: you still need a clean drip tray, dry seals, and regular wipe-downs to remove the source of smells.
The same chemistry that makes eyes water—compounds related to syn-propanethial-S-oxide—also nudges odours off-centre by competing for your nose’s attention. Combine this with adsorption on the onion’s fibrous surface and you get that surprisingly swift freshening. It’s a clever stopgap until you can wash shelves with warm water and a little bicarbonate of soda.
A Quick Method: Freshness in About 60 Seconds
Use a thin slice of onion or a handful of dry skins; scraps have enough reactive sulphur without overwhelming the cavity. Place them in a shallow dish on the middle shelf where airflow is best. Close the door and wait. In around a minute you’ll sense a cleaner profile, particularly if the smell came from transient sources such as opened packaging. Remove or replace the scrap within 12–24 hours to avoid flavour transfer to butter, milk, and uncovered produce. For a gentler touch, fan a few papery skins instead of a juicy slice; they emit fewer volatiles but still help.
If time allows, do a quick reset: bin any spoiled items, wipe spills, and run a soft cloth dipped in diluted bicarbonate of soda along seals and shelves. Dry thoroughly to deter bacterial growth—wet corners can breed pong. Keep pungent foods covered, and store onions themselves outside the fridge unless they’re cut. Cut onion must be wrapped tightly and used within a day or two.
Onion vs Other Deodorisers: What Works Best
An onion scrap is cheap, fast and often effective, but it’s not a long-term filter. For sustained freshness, compare it with kitchen staples designed for adsorption. Activated charcoal and bicarbonate of soda excel over days and weeks, while coffee grounds offer swift masking at the expense of adding their own aroma. The smartest approach is layered: onion for the quick win, bicarbonate or charcoal for the marathon, plus basic hygiene to remove the root cause.
| Method | Primary Action | Speed to Notice | Advantages | Watch-outs | Cost |
|---|---|---|---|---|---|
| Onion scrap | Reactive sulphur + mild adsorption | ~1 minute | Very fast, readily available | Potential flavour transfer; replace within 24h | Low |
| Bicarbonate of soda | Adsorption/acid–base neutralisation | Hours to a day | Neutral, food-safe, long-lasting | Slow start; needs periodic stirring/replacement | Low |
| Activated charcoal | High-surface-area adsorption | Minutes to hours | Powerful, odour-agnostic | Must be contained; messy if spilled | Moderate |
| Coffee grounds | Aroma masking + light adsorption | Minutes | Pleasant scent for some | Adds coffee note; mould if damp | Low |
For best results, pair a fast-acting fix with a slow, silent absorber and routine cleaning. Keep a small open jar of bicarbonate or a charcoal sachet tucked at the back; deploy an onion scrap when strong smells break out after fish night or a curry container leaks. Always cover dairy, eggs and cut fruit. The goal is to prevent odours from forming, then neutralise what slips through.
